How much does a Arborist make?

The average salary for a Arborist is $61,972 per year in the US.

Arborists care for trees and shrubs, ensuring they are healthy and safe. They work in parks, forests, and private properties. The average yearly salary for an arborist is around $61,972. This means most arborists earn between $36,000 and $150,000 each year. The salary can vary based on experience, location, and the type of employer.

The salary distribution shows that many arborists earn between $36,000 and $77,000. This range covers the lower and middle parts of the salary scale. A smaller number of arborists earn more than $100,000. These higher salaries often go to those with more experience or specialized skills. The highest earners in the field make over $139,000 a year.

How to earn more as a Arborist?

Arborists can increase their earnings by focusing on several key areas. First, gaining specialized certifications can open up higher-paying job opportunities. Certifications from recognized organizations like the International Society of Arboriculture (ISA) can set an arborist apart from the competition. These credentials demonstrate a higher level of expertise and can lead to more demanding and better-paying jobs.

Experience also plays a crucial role in earning potential. Arborists with more years in the field often command higher wages. Working on a variety of projects and gaining a broad range of skills can make an arborist more versatile and valuable to employers. Networking within the industry can lead to referrals and recommendations, which can result in higher-paying jobs. Additionally, taking on leadership roles or starting a private arborist business can significantly increase income. Finally, staying updated on the latest industry trends and technologies can make an arborist more efficient and effective, leading to higher earnings.
